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om the 78744 ZIP Code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in 78744 with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in 78744 is at Buron Lane Apartments listed at $1,170.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om 78744 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in 78744 is $1,622.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om 78744 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in 78744 is a 1,355 square feet unit starting from $2,590 at Rooftop 252.

What is the average size for 78744 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
